Over the weekend of 30 April and 1 May Moora hosted the Moora Toyota Horse Trials, drawing 292 horses and over 500 riders and spectators to town. The Moora region was represented by 12 junior and senior riders; some riders attending their first ever One Day Event and others achieving personal best results. With a total rainfall of 62 ml for the month of April, the grounds were green and soft under foot – a stark contrast to years gone by with dry Aprils and not a blade of grass in sight. Weekend conditions were perfect with both days sunny and cool.
The grounds were a hive of activity in the 2 weeks leading up to the event. Works undertaken included the complete resurfacing of the main show-jumping arena, top-dressing of the dressage surface and a new river crossing opened up connecting the back paddock to the main grounds. These were all finalised at the very last minute and held up wonderfully. The new surface in the main arena was lovely under foot and the upgrade was appreciated by all riders.
This year’s cross country courses proved challenging to some horse and rider combinations, but most riders finished with a big smile on their face. This year the CNC*, CNC** and EvA105 courses were designed by Tom Compagnoni of Perth who has been a great supporter of the event for many years. The EvA95 and EvA80 course was designed by local rider Lucy Atty and the EvA65 and PC45 was designed by local rider Jemma Vanzetti. Lucy and Jemma are both in the process of receiving their course designers accreditation.
Each phase ran smoothly and on time with the final competitor riding at 3:40 and the event officially closing at 5:15. It is a credit to the event committee and organisers to be able to run such a large scale event and finish in such a timely manner.
